Uploaded image for project: 'Couchbase Server'
  1. Couchbase Server
  2. MB-50754

The non-root installer shouldn't get the version from the file name

    XMLWordPrintable

Details

    • Improvement
    • Resolution: Unresolved
    • Critical
    • Morpheus
    • 7.1.0
    • tools
    • None
    • 1

    Description

      What is the issue?
      The installer uses the provided package name to determine the version, which seems like a very naive and unreliable solution. It also doesn't work for build packages from latestbuils that use internal names instead of numerical versions like couchbase-server-enterprise-neo-centos7.x86_64.rpm.

      Terminal error:

      [vagrant@node1-cb702-centos7 cb-non-package-installer-master]$ ./cb-non-package-installer --install --install-location ./cb-install --package ./couchbase-server-enterprise-neo-centos7.x86_64.rpm
      2022/02/02T13:16:40 ERROR: Could not get version from Package name couchbase-server-enterprise-neo-centos7.x86_64.rpm
      

      Attachments

        Issue Links

          No reviews matched the request. Check your Options in the drop-down menu of this sections header.

          Activity

            People

              owend Daniel Owen
              maks.januska Maksimiljans Januska
              Votes:
              0 Vote for this issue
              Watchers:
              2 Start watching this issue

              Dates

                Created:
                Updated:

                Gerrit Reviews

                  There are no open Gerrit changes

                  PagerDuty